Coca-Cola has never come up with such a product in its history
For the first time in its history, Coca-Cola is launching its own alcoholic beverage – origo wrote. After a successful test period in Japan, a product recalling the taste of the popular soft drink – chu-hi – is on the shelves in Japan.
The Coca Cola manufacturer plans to launch its own version of Japan’s popular chu-hi beverage, a local carbonated beverage specialty with citrus and charcoal spirit.
The drink is expected to be available in three strengths, between 3% and 7% alcohol, and will be available from October. (origo)
